Where to start from in Coatbridge? Where do I arrive in Edinburgh?

Coatbridge Departure Stations

Blairhill
Map
Coatbridge Sunnyside
Map
Coatdyke
Map

Edinburgh Arrival Stations

Edinburgh Park
Map
Edinburgh Waverley
Map
Haymarket (Edinburgh)
